64 THE PASSIONATE DETACHMENT 23 SAILOZ MOOKHERJEA (1907 — 60) National Art Treasure Landscape Signed in English, l.r. Watercolour, mid 1950s 122 x 91 cm. (48.0 x 35.8”) Rs. 500,000 - 600,000 Non-Exportable Item “ His paintings though not many in number are important as harbingers of the new attitude towards painting and the “art about art” of the mid-twentieth century…Sailoz has to be considered one of the major figures in modern Indian art. In the 1940’s he did indeed enjoy a reputation and popularity few Indian artists have since been able to rival... Sailoz was proud to be an artist. There is a cold impersonality and ambiguity in modern art from which his work was free. His painting was vibrant and positive, clearly a result of his convictions and temperament; he rejected disappointment and difficulties. He was a man with the soul of a pilgrim, the hand of the artist, the eye of a poet.”(Jaya Appasamy, rpt. in LKA Monograph 1966 ).
